Output bf65c268028608fbe76b099972fb8b6a5b7961ba22619e00a60d89f0f81c6f60:0

value
75426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a095acb7a1dc1a5f76240de27cacf3bdc91c12 OP_EQUAL
address
3DR8niVshkrxNX4vkuEHva9JoK1ocvb4Dq
transaction
bf65c268028608fbe76b099972fb8b6a5b7961ba22619e00a60d89f0f81c6f60
confirmations
123761
spent
true